Top rated
5512 views22222
(3 votes)
4786 views22222
(3 votes)
4676 views22222
(3 votes)
4847 views22222
(3 votes)
4968 views22222
(3 votes)
4084 views22222
(3 votes)
3858 views22222
(3 votes)
3882 views22222
(3 votes)
3855 views22222
(3 votes)
3988 views22222
(3 votes)
3908 views22222
(3 votes)
3881 views22222
(3 votes)
1387 files on 116 page(s)